Abstract: A device providing temporary pairing for wireless devices may include a memory and at least one processor configured to receive a request to temporarily pair with a wireless device. The at least one processor may be further configured to pair with the wireless device, wherein the pairing comprises generating a link key for connecting to the wireless device. The at least one processor may be further configured to connect to the wireless device using the link key. The at least one processor may be further configured to initiate a timer upon disconnecting from the wireless device. The at least one processor may be further configured to automatically and without user input, delete the link key when the timer reaches a timeout value without having reconnected to the wireless device using the link key.

Abstract: Some embodiments provide a method for an electronic device. The method stores user data associated with a web-based third party service based on user interaction with a web domain for the third party service through a web browser. The method receives a request from a service-specific application to utilize the user data stored for the third party service. The method provides the user data to the application only when the application is verified by the web domain for receiving user data associated with the third party service.

Abstract: This application relates to techniques that adjust the sleep states of a computing device based on proximity detection and predicted user activity. Proximity detection procedures can be used to determine a proximity between the computing device and a remote computing device coupled to the user. Based on these proximity detection procedures, the computing device can either correspondingly increase or decrease the amount power supplied to the various components during either a low-power sleep state or a high-power sleep state. Additionally, historical user activity data gathered on the computing device can be used to predict when the user will likely use the computing device. Based on the gathered historical user activity, deep sleep signals and light sleep signals can be issued at a time when the computing device is placed within a sleep state which can cause it to immediately enter either a low-power sleep state or a high-power sleep state.

Abstract: This application relates to a computing device that can be configured to implement a method for enabling a nearby computing device to access a wireless network by carrying out the techniques described herein. In particular, the method can include the steps of (1) receiving a request from the nearby computing device to access the wireless network, where the request includes user information associated with the nearby computing device, (2) presenting a notification associated with the request in response to determining, based on the user information, that the nearby computing device is recognized by the computing device, and (3) in response to receiving an approval for the nearby computing device to access the wireless network: providing, to the nearby computing device, a password for accessing the wireless network.

Abstract: Disclosed herein is a technique for managing permissions associated with the control of a host device that are provided to a group of wireless devices. The host device is configured to pair with a first wireless device. In response to pairing with the first wireless device, the host device grants a first level of permissions for controlling the host device to the first wireless device. Subsequently, the host device can receive a second request from a second wireless device to pair with the host device. In response to pairing with the second wireless device, the host device can grant a second level of permissions for controlling the host device to second wireless device, where the second level of permissions is distinct from the first level of permissions.

Abstract: A device implementing dynamic controller selection may include a processor configured to generate a connectivity graph based on a scan for accessory devices, the connectivity graph including a connectivity metric value for a discovered accessory device. The processor may be configured to broadcast the connectivity graph and receive another connectivity graph broadcasted by another electronic device that includes another connectivity metric value for the accessory device. The processor may be configured to receive a request to provide an instruction to the accessory device and determine which of the electronic devices will provide the instruction based on the connectivity metric values. The processor may be further configured to, when the electronic device is determined, provide the instruction for transmission to the accessory device, and when the other electronic device is determined, provide, for transmission to the other electronic device, the instruction to be provided to the accessory device.
